About the company
Speedy Hire Plc, together with its subsidiaries, provides tools and equipment hire and services to the construction, infrastructure, and industrial markets in the United Kingdom and Ireland. The company operates through Hire and Services segments. The Hire segment offers small tools, access, power and battery storage, lifting, survey, powered access, and welding and plant machinery. The Services segment includes a range of re-hire solutions; management and sale of fuel and energy; training services; and product sales, as well as test, inspection, and certification services.
